A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Cross-Platform-Entwicklung Eingaben in TEdit "doppeln" sich bei Android App
Thema durchsuchen
Ansicht
Themen-Optionen

Eingaben in TEdit "doppeln" sich bei Android App

Ein Thema von skoschke · begonnen am 24. Sep 2018 · letzter Beitrag vom 6. Okt 2018
Antwort Antwort
Seite 1 von 2  1 2      
skoschke

Registriert seit: 6. Jan 2009
523 Beiträge
 
Delphi 10.4 Sydney
 
#1

Eingaben in TEdit "doppeln" sich bei Android App

  Alt 24. Sep 2018, 10:35
Hallo,

ich stehe vor einem Phänomen bei einem Kunden mit einem Galaxy S9, welches mir leider nicht zur Verfügung steht:

Er tippt eine Mailadresse ein, ich schreib mal vorn die getippten Buchstaben und dahinter das was dann im Edit steht:

i i
n in
f inf
o info
@ info@
e info@e
l info@einfo@el

auf all meinen Devices ist das nicht nachvollziehbar, beim Kunden auf einem Tab3 auch nicht!
Wo könnte man nun ansetzen?
Spielt da irgendeine automatische Ergänzung einen Streich?

Ciao
Stefan
  Mit Zitat antworten Zitat
knaeuel

Registriert seit: 2. Jul 2007
110 Beiträge
 
Delphi 10.3 Rio
 
#2

AW: Eingaben in TEdit "doppeln" sich bei Android App

  Alt 24. Sep 2018, 11:57
passiert das immer genau bei der eingabe des 7. zeichens?
oder kann es jederzeit dazwischen schießen?

passiert es bei beliebigem text?
oder muss es diese emailadresse oder zumindest eine beliebige emailadresse sein?
Wolfgang
  Mit Zitat antworten Zitat
Aviator

Registriert seit: 3. Jun 2010
1.611 Beiträge
 
Delphi 10.3 Rio
 
#3

AW: Eingaben in TEdit "doppeln" sich bei Android App

  Alt 24. Sep 2018, 12:12
Ich programmiere zwar keine Android Apps, kenne es aber von einer App die ich nutze auch. Ich vermute auch, dass es mit einer Art Autovervollständigung zu tun hat. Es passiert dann, wenn man einen Benutzer mit dem "@" Zeichen taggen will. In dem Moment öffnet sich eine Auswahlliste von möglichen Benutzern, die mit den eingegebenen Buchstaben beginnen. Wählt man diesen Benutzer nun aus der Liste aus und schreibt danach ein Zeichen, wird der zuvor geschriebene Text, vom "@" Zeichen bis zu dem Zeitpunkt an dem man den Benutzer aus der Liste ausgewählt hat, nochmal übernommen.


So sieht das dann z.B. aus:
Code:
Hallo @Te
        ^- Hier wird dann der Benutzer gewählt

Nun wird z.B. das Wort "Hallo" geschrieben und das folgende erscheint:

Hallo @Test @TeHallo
  Mit Zitat antworten Zitat
skoschke

Registriert seit: 6. Jan 2009
523 Beiträge
 
Delphi 10.4 Sydney
 
#4

AW: Eingaben in TEdit "doppeln" sich bei Android App

  Alt 24. Sep 2018, 12:53
passiert das immer genau bei der eingabe des 7. zeichens?
oder kann es jederzeit dazwischen schießen?

passiert es bei beliebigem text?
oder muss es diese emailadresse oder zumindest eine beliebige emailadresse sein?
Nein, es ist nicht das 7. Zeichen, es passiert auch mit einem "-" anstelle des "@"
Es muss auch keine Mailadresse sein

Ciao
Stefan
  Mit Zitat antworten Zitat
skoschke

Registriert seit: 6. Jan 2009
523 Beiträge
 
Delphi 10.4 Sydney
 
#5

AW: Eingaben in TEdit "doppeln" sich bei Android App

  Alt 24. Sep 2018, 12:55
Hallo Aviator,

das von Dir beschriebene Verhalten passt komplett!
Allerdings gibt es keine Benutzerauswahl, aber da könnte die Wortvorschlagsliste irgendwie beteiligt sein...
Nur wie schaltet man das ab?

Ciao
Stefan
  Mit Zitat antworten Zitat
QuickAndDirty

Registriert seit: 13. Jan 2004
Ort: Hamm(Westf)
1.944 Beiträge
 
Delphi 12 Athens
 
#6

AW: Eingaben in TEdit "doppeln" sich bei Android App

  Alt 24. Sep 2018, 15:26
Passiert es auch wenn man eine Alternative Tastatur installiert und in den Einstellungen auswählt? aus dem Playstore z.b. Swiftkey(umsonst) oder Swipe(k.A.)
Andreas
Monads? Wtf are Monads?
  Mit Zitat antworten Zitat
skoschke

Registriert seit: 6. Jan 2009
523 Beiträge
 
Delphi 10.4 Sydney
 
#7

AW: Eingaben in TEdit "doppeln" sich bei Android App

  Alt 24. Sep 2018, 16:21
Das wäre eine Idee, muss den Kunden nur mal versuchen dazu zu bringen, eine andere Tastatur zu verwenden...

Ciao
Stefan
  Mit Zitat antworten Zitat
sko1

Registriert seit: 27. Jan 2017
601 Beiträge
 
Delphi 10.1 Berlin Enterprise
 
#8

AW: Eingaben in TEdit "doppeln" sich bei Android App

  Alt 25. Sep 2018, 13:15
Kunde lehnt die Installation einer alternativen Tastatur ab, hat aber inzwischen gefunden, dass es eine Option "intelligentes Tippen" gibt und diese abgeschaltet.
Damit ist der Effekt weg...

Ciao
Stefan
  Mit Zitat antworten Zitat
Benutzerbild von Olli73
Olli73

Registriert seit: 25. Apr 2008
Ort: Neunkirchen
755 Beiträge
 
#9

AW: Eingaben in TEdit "doppeln" sich bei Android App

  Alt 25. Sep 2018, 13:17
hat aber inzwischen gefunden, dass es eine Option "intelligentes Tippen" gibt
Na die Funktion scheint ja sehr intelligent zu sein. Samsung kann halt alles, außer Software.
  Mit Zitat antworten Zitat
QuickAndDirty

Registriert seit: 13. Jan 2004
Ort: Hamm(Westf)
1.944 Beiträge
 
Delphi 12 Athens
 
#10

AW: Eingaben in TEdit "doppeln" sich bei Android App

  Alt 2. Okt 2018, 14:44
Kunde lehnt die Installation einer alternativen Tastatur ab,
Der Kunde mag also keine Tests durchführen die potentiell ein Problem bei ihm aufdecken könnten. Netter Kunde!

hat aber inzwischen gefunden, dass es eine Option "intelligentes Tippen" gibt und diese abgeschaltet.
Er hat also das Problem das nicht in deiner App lag sondern in den Einstellungen der Keyboard App des Herstellers gefunden, aber er hat dich suchen lassen?

Damit ist der Effekt weg...

Ciao
Stefan
Zum glück hast du keine Zeit beim beheben seines Problems mit seinen Einstellungen und seiner Keybord App verschwendet.
Andreas
Monads? Wtf are Monads?
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 1 von 2  1 2      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 21:57 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z